Role Overview
The ServiceNow Business Analyst (HRSD specialism) is a key member of the NTT DATA ServiceNow Practice, embedded within a product domain and working closely with the Product Owner, Delivery Manager, and development team. The role is responsible for gathering, translating, and managing business requirements through the full delivery lifecycle — from stakeholder workshops through to development story creation, testing coordination, and release sign-off.
The BA acts as the bridge between business stakeholders and technical delivery, ensuring that what is built accurately reflects the outcomes the business needs and aligns to the product roadmap. Although domain-aligned, the BA is part of a shared pool and may support other capability areas when capacity requires.
Key Responsibilities
- Lead and facilitate workshops with business stakeholders to elicit, capture, and validate requirements, ensuring outcomes and objectives are clearly understood before entering the development pipeline.
- Translate business requirements into clearly written, development-ready user stories, acceptance criteria, and process maps in line with the agreed product roadmap.
- Own and maintain the requirements backlog for the product domain, keeping stories refined, prioritised, and ready for sprint intake in collaboration with the Product Owner.
- Support the Sprint Intake Review by ensuring stories are sufficiently detailed and acceptance criteria are agreed before development begins.
- Coordinate and actively participate in functional testing and UAT, validating that developed functionality meets the defined acceptance criteria and business outcome.
- Act as a liaison between the business and QA function to ensure test cases are aligned to requirements and that business stakeholders are engaged in sign-off activities.
- Identify and document scope changes, risks, and dependencies, escalating to the Delivery Manager and Product Owner where appropriate.
- Contribute to Release Readout sessions, supporting communication of what has been delivered and gathering feedback for continuous improvement.
- Maintain clear and accurate requirements documentation throughout the project lifecycle, ensuring traceability from requirement through to delivery.
- Support the HRSD Product Owner in translating People & Culture service requirements into ServiceNow HRSD configuration, including Case Management, Lifecycle Events, Journey Accelerators, and Employee Centre.
- Engage with HR, P&C, and employee experience stakeholders to understand service delivery pain points and desired outcomes, facilitating workshops to gather and validate requirements.
- Ensure HRSD requirements are documented with appropriate sensitivity to employee data, privacy, and HR policy boundaries — maintaining a clear distinction between platform capability and HR process ownership.
Essential Experience & Skills
- Proven experience as a Business Analyst in an enterprise IT or digital transformation environment.
- Strong skills in requirements elicitation, workshop facilitation, and stakeholder management across multiple levels of seniority.
- Experience writing high-quality user stories and acceptance criteria for agile development teams.
- Ability to coordinate and support testing activities, including defining test scenarios, coordinating UAT, and managing sign-off processes.
- Excellent communication and documentation skills — able to translate complex business needs into clear, actionable requirements.
- Comfortable working in a fast-paced, agile delivery environment with multiple concurrent workstreams.
- Demonstrable experience working on ServiceNow HRSD implementations or enhancements, with hands-on familiarity with HRSD modules including Case Management, Lifecycle Events, or Employee Centre Pro.
- Experience working with HR, People & Culture, or employee experience stakeholders — comfortable navigating sensitive HR subject matter.
- Understanding of how HR processes and policies translate into ServiceNow configuration, and where the boundary between platform and process ownership sits.
